MINUTES — Management Meeting, Pricing Review

Present: Varrow, Tidmarsh, Oleska. Topic: Fennick product line pricing.

Decisions: list price up 4% from next quarter; volume discount threshold raised to 500 units; Brassfield promo pricing ends this month. Sales leads to communicate changes to key accounts within two weeks. Objections from the Lowmarket segment noted, no change. One item was raised for restricted circulation.

confidential, kagep-kahof: Druokax Systems plans to lower the Ulaath list price by 53 percent in March.

Subject: Key rotation — GrowCell controller API

Team, we rotated the GrowCell service key as part of the sensor drift investigation. Humidity sensors in Bay 3 were drifting about 4% per week; recalibration is scheduled. Support tools that query controller telemetry will need the new credential by Thursday, or drift dashboards will show gaps. The new key is below.

service key, yadug-bajog: zpat3_pou

Subject: Handover — validator plugin stuff

Hey Priya,

Passing you the baton on Checkwright, our plugin system for data validators. The new schema-drift plugin shipped Tuesday and mostly behaves, but it occasionally flags empty CSV uploads as "malformed" — harmless, just noisy. I've muted the alert until Friday. If support escalates anything about plugin load failures, the fix is usually bumping the registry cache. Questions after I'm off? Reach the Checkwright maintainers at the address below.

billing contact of hawip-kahif = zorwyn@tolvaqlabs.corp

TICKET-4410: Dedup vault locked

The Hollowpine alert deduplicator can't read its suppression-rule vault after last night's rotation. Result: duplicate pages firing for every flapping check. Merge logic itself is fine; it's purely a vault auth failure. Raising for weekly sync visibility. Mitigation: restore vault access, replay suppressed window, confirm page counts drop. Owner: Dren, backup Saskia. Until rotation tooling is fixed, the vault accepts the standing recovery passphrase, which is recorded below.

strongbox words: wenix-ulador